Paraguayan Divorced or Separated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 95,099,357 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Paraguayans and percentage of population currently divorced or separated in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.011 and weighted average of 11.5%. On average, for every 1% (one percent) increase in Paraguayans within a typical geography, there is a decrease of 0.025% in percentage of population currently divorced or separated.
It is essential to understand that the correlation between the percentage of Paraguayans and percentage of population currently divorced or separated does not imply a direct cause-and-effect relationship. It remains uncertain whether the presence of Paraguayans influences an upward or downward trend in the level of percentage of population currently divorced or separated within an area, or if Paraguayans simply ended up residing in those areas with higher or lower levels of percentage of population currently divorced or separated due to other factors.
